There is an expiry date on the tub you can look for reference. However, if the GOCHUJANG still looks and smells like when you first opened it, it’s good to use. … It does have preservatives added, but it may be best to keep in the fridge and consume by (or nearby) the best before date listed- usually 2 years.

Regarding this, Is gochujang same as Gochugaru? Both lend a distinct flavor to Korean dishes, but gochujang has a much more complex flavor than gochugaru due to the fermenting process it undergoes. Gochugaru simply provides a bit of heat and smokiness, while gochujang provides a sweet, tangy, and spicy flavor.

How do you pronounce gochujang in Korean? The name “gochujang” derives from gochu, which means “chili pepper” in Korean and jang, which means “paste” in Korean. The correct pronunciation of gochujang is koh-choo-jan(g). In the first syllable of gochujang, the “g” is pronounced like a “k” and it is followed by an “o” that is pronounced with a closed “oh” sound.

Beside above, How do you store Gojuchang?

Once opened, gochujang should be stored in the refrigerator. Like miso, it has quite a long shelf life, as long as it hasn’t dried out or changed in color.

Is Ssamjang or gochujang better?

Comparing their uses in cooking

Ssamjang is commonly used as a dipping sauce. Barbecued meat and vegetables will both benefit from this condiment’s spicy, umami flavor. … Gochujang is excellent in stews, soups, dips, and as a marinade on meat dishes. One of its best-known uses is in bibimbap, Korea’s national rice dish.

Can I replace gochugaru with gochujang for kimchi? Traditionally speaking, gochujang should not be used instead of gochugaru for making kimchi. Although both are spicy, they are generally not interchangeable. … Kimchi, or fermented vegetables, is traditionally made with many ingredients – one of which is gochugaru (Korean red pepper flakes).

Can gochujang be used for kimchi? Gochujang chili paste (since it is quite spicy, the amount of chili flakes should be decreased). This is a short-cut to make kimchi and different from traditional way, but very efficient since Gochujang has already fermented, thus easily stimulating the fermentation of kimchi, even when the kimchi is not salty enough.

Does gochujang have Sesame?

Ingredients: gochujang paste (chile pepper flakes, malt syrup, wheat flour, salt, fermented soybean powder, sweet rice powder), sesame oil, toasted sesame seeds, chile pepper flakes, sugar, soy sauce (water, wheat, soybeans, salt), citric acid. This product contains wheat, sesame, and soy.

Why is alcohol used in gochujang? The process of fermentation produces trace amounts of alcohol (which is haram- prohibited) but the same happens with yogurt, pickles and kefir. Not only this, but it is common practice to add alcohol as a preservative to increase shelf life.

Why is gochujang haram?

Because the alcohol is only the byproduct of fermentation process. The company ADD ALCOHOL in their 고추장(gochujang). It’s not naturally fermented. … So, most of Korean traditional foods using 고추장 are totally Haram.

What percentage of alcohol is in gochujang?

First, ethanol content in 25 traditional gochujang was measured by gas chromatography with flame ion detector, widely accepted as the conventional method of alcohol detection. The content ranged from 0.14 to 2.7%.

What can be used instead of gochujang? Grocery store alternatives: Sriracha chili sauce or a Thai chili paste. Sometimes Sriracha can make a decent alternative to gochujang, depending on the need. If the chili paste is simply being used as a heat source and not starring in an authentic Korean recipe, you can give consideration to Sriracha.

Is Taekyung the same as gochugaru? In the world of gochugaru, that means looking for the words “sun-dried” (also “taekyung”/“taeyangcho”) on the package. Look for coarse flakes, which resemble flaky sea salt, and are the go-to style in Korean kitchens (finer gochugaru is often used for making gochujang.)

Can I substitute red pepper flakes for gochugaru? Use gochugaru as a substitute for red pepper flakes if what you need is a mild heat. … The big difference will be the appearance since gochugaru does not have seeds. Red pepper flakes are a workable but not ideal substitute for gochugaru , especially when it comes to applications like kimchi.
